How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Franklin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Franklin Park Studio Apartments | $1,203 | $867 | $1,395 |
Franklin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,308 | $713 | $4,427 |
Franklin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,708 | $999 | $5,942 |
Franklin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,941 | $700 | $8,425 |
Franklin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,076 | $1,783 | $2,276 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Franklin Park Apartments with Hardwood Floors
What is the Cheapest Hardwood Floors apartment in Franklin Park?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Franklin Park with Hardwood Floors is at Grace Woods listed at $679.
How much is the average rent for Franklin Park Apartments with Hardwood Floors?
The average rent for a Apartment in Franklin Park with Hardwood Floors is $1,697.
What is the largest Franklin Park Apartment for rent with Hardwood Floors?
Today's Apartment with Hardwood Floors and the most square footage in Franklin Park is a 1,721 square feet unit starting from $1,154 at Bexley SoCo.
What is the average size for Franklin Park Apartments for rent with Hardwood Floors?
The average size for a rental with Hardwood Floors in Franklin Park is currently at 609 sq ft.
